27-31-103. District court jurisdiction. Applications for change of names must be heard and determined by the district court.

Terms Used In Montana Code 27-31-103

  • Jurisdiction: (1) The legal authority of a court to hear and decide a case. Concurrent jurisdiction exists when two courts have simultaneous responsibility for the same case. (2) The geographic area over which the court has authority to decide cases.
